PORTLAND, Ore. – Logan Christensen scored the winner as the Saskatoon Blades toppled the Portland Winterhawks 3-1 Saturday. Connor Gay and Mason McCarty, into an empty net, also chipped in for the Blades (17-25-3).

Evan Weinger had the lone goal for Portland (22-20-2).

The Blades take on the Everett Silvertips on Monday.
